Summary

Shadow Hills Elementary is a K-5 public school in the Fontana Unified district, serving 364 students in a neighborhood where it sits close to several other elementary schools with a range of academic performance.

Academically, the school performs below state averages, with particular challenges in mathematics, though it shows a notable strength in science where it outperforms its district average. A striking feature is the school's dramatic and successful improvement in student attendance, with chronic absenteeism dropping from 38.6% to 17.9% in three years—a rate now better than the district, state, and many nearby schools like Live Oak Elementary and Poplar Elementary. However, performance varies significantly between student groups, with a large gap between female and male students and very low scores for students in special education.

Interestingly, Shadow Hills operates with significantly less funding per student than schools in neighboring districts like Jurupa Unified and Colton Joint Unified. Despite this, its attendance and science results are competitive. The school's performance has been unstable in recent years but appears to be recovering from a pandemic-era low, though it has not yet matched the higher rankings of nearby schools in its own district, such as Canyon Crest Elementary and Oak Park Elementary.
